[Amazon.ca] Blink Outdoor 3rd Gen + Floodlight — wireless $120 ($60 off)

Blink Outdoor 3rd Gen + Floodlight — wireless, battery-powered HD floodlight mount and smart security camera, 700 lumens, motion detection, set up in minutes — 1 camera kit

Includes one Blink Outdoor camera, one floodlight mount, one Sync Module 2, one mounting bracket, two 1.5V AA lithium metal batteries, four D-Cell batteries, one mounting kit, one USB cable, one power adapter, and one right angle adapter.

i've had nothing but terrible experiences with blink.
it doesn't seem to care about areas of detection, it constantly goes off to show nothing, OR it doesn't go off at all, or it takes so long to start recording the person is already moving away from my door and it misses the whole time they walked in.

There is a limit to the continuous live viewing on the Blink cameras. Currently, you are able to view up to 5 minutes at a time in 30 second intervals.

which suck....
